Patent number: 10957957Abstract: A phase shifter according to at least one embodiment of the present disclosure has a housing provided on both surfaces with respective shifting units. Each shifting unit is composed of a fixed board and a moving board. Movement of the moving board causes a phase-shifted signal to be simultaneously transferred from both surfaces of the housing to output ports. This allows more effective use of the space of the phase shifter and therearound.Type: GrantFiled: July 31, 2018Date of Patent: March 23, 2021Assignee: KMW INC.Inventors: Sung-hwan So, Seong-man Kang, Eun-suk Jung, Dae-myung Park, Sang-hun Lee

Patent number: 10886966Abstract: Disclosed herein are a method for eliminating passive intermodulation distortion (PIMD) and an antenna apparatus using the same. According to an embodiment, the antenna apparatus includes a main antenna used for transmission and reception of an RF signal; an auxiliary antenna used for reception of an RF signal; and a passive intermodulation distortion (PIMD) eliminator configured to calculate PIMD contained in a received signal of the main antenna using a received signal of the auxiliary antenna, and to eliminate the calculated PIMD from the received signal of the main antenna.Type: GrantFiled: May 17, 2019Date of Patent: January 5, 2021Assignee: KMW INC.Inventors: Young Chan Moon, Min Seon Yun, Sung-hwan So

Patent number: 10707563Abstract: A multi-polarized radiating element of the present disclosure includes first, second, third, and fourth radiating arms arranged in a four-way symmetrical manner on a plane; a first feeding line commonly fed to the fourth radiating arm and the first radiating arm, and commonly grounded to the second radiating arm and the third radiating arm; and a second feeding line commonly fed to the first radiating arm and the second radiating arm, and commonly grounded to the third radiating arm and the fourth radiating arm.Type: GrantFiled: March 8, 2018Date of Patent: July 7, 2020Assignee: KMW INC.Inventors: Sung-Hwan So, Hun-Jung Jung, Kwang-Seok Choi, Jae-Jung Choi

Patent number: 10608331Abstract: The present disclosure relates to an antenna device for a mobile communication system, including a reflection plate, a service band separator/coupler and a radome. The reflection plate is configured in a plate shape, multiple radiation elements being mounted on one surface of the reflection plate so as to transmit/receive radio signals. The service band separator/coupler is installed on the other surface of the reflection plate so as to separate/couple the service band of the corresponding antenna device. The radome is configured in the shape of an integrated barrel that surrounds the reflection plate and the service band separator/coupler as a whole.Type: GrantFiled: March 3, 2017Date of Patent: March 31, 2020Assignee: KMW INC.Inventors: Sung-Hwan So, Seong-Man Kang, Eun-Suk Jung, Sang-Hun Lee, Dae-Myung Park

Patent number: 10249940Abstract: A signal distributing/combining apparatus in an antenna device of a mobile communication base station includes a circuit board configured to have an upper surface formed with a signal distributing/combining conductor pattern for a high frequency signal distributing/combining operation, and a support plate configured to have an upper mounting surface of a size corresponding to the circuit board, to mate with the circuit board so that an underside of the circuit board is in close contact with the upper mounting surface for supporting the circuit board, and to fixedly mate with the antenna device at a reflection plate on a bottom side of the support plate. The support plate is provided with a plurality of cable holders for supporting and fixating coaxial cables for signal transmission which are connected from outside of the apparatus.Type: GrantFiled: September 15, 2017Date of Patent: April 2, 2019Assignee: KMW INC.Inventors: Young-Chan Moon, Sung-Hwan So, Hun-Jung Jung, Kwang-Seok Choi, Jae-Jeng Choi
